Game of Thrones is one of the most famous TV shows ever made. It is a fantasy story full of kings, queens, dragons, and battles. The show is based on Game of Thrones books written by George R. R. Martin. The story follows many families fighting for the Iron Throne. This throne rules the Seven Kingdoms of Westeros.
What makes game of thrones special is how real it feels. Heroes can fail. Villains can win. Big characters can die suddenly. The show mixes magic with human emotions like love, fear, and power. The World of Westeros and the Game of Thrones Map
The world of game of thrones feels huge and alive. It includes lands like the North, King’s Landing, and Essos. A game of thrones map helps fans understand where events happen. The North is cold and harsh. The South is warm and full of politics. Across the sea lies Essos, where dragons rise.
One famous road is the game of thrones Kingsroad. It connects the North to King’s Landing. Many key moments happen along this road. It shows how travel shapes the story.
If you ever wondered where was game of thrones filmed, many scenes were shot in Northern Ireland, Croatia, Spain, and Iceland. These real places helped make Westeros feel real. Visiting these spots today feels like walking into the show.

Game of Thrones Seasons and Episodes Explained
Many viewers ask, how many seasons of Game of Thrones are there? The answer is eight. There are 73 total game of thrones episodes. Each season grows bigger and darker.
Game of Thrones season 1 introduces the world and main families. Game of Thrones season 7 builds toward the final war. Fans also ask, how many episodes in season 8 of Game of Thrones? Season 8 has six episodes.
If you wonder when did Game of Thrones end, the final episode aired in 2019. The ending sparked strong debates and emotions worldwide.

Game of Thrones Books in Order
The TV show comes from Game of Thrones books. Many ask, how many Game of Thrones books are there? There are five published books so far.
Game of Thrones books in order:
- A Game of Thrones
- A Clash of Kings
- A Storm of Swords
- A Feast for Crows
- A Dance with Dragons
The books offer more detail than the show. Reading them helps you understand characters better.
Who Was the Mad King in Game of Thrones?
People often ask, who was the Mad King in Game of Thrones? The Mad King was Aerys II Targaryen. He ruled before the show begins.
If you ask, who is the Mad King in Game of Thrones, the answer is the same. His madness and cruelty caused rebellion. His actions shaped the entire story.
